Major Orange County, North Carolina Real Estate Markets

Chapel Hill dominates Orange County's real estate activity, serving as both the county seat and home to UNC, creating a market where historic neighborhoods like Franklin-Rosemary and Gimghoul command seven-figure prices while student-oriented properties near campus maintain steady rental demand. The city's downtown revitalization has sparked condominium development and mixed-use projects, while established neighborhoods like Meadowmont and Southern Village represent master-planned communities that attract families and professionals seeking resort-style amenities within an academic setting.

Carrboro has emerged as the county's creative hub, where former mill villages have transformed into trendy neighborhoods attracting artists, musicians, and young professionals drawn to its walkable downtown and progressive culture. Meanwhile, smaller communities like Hillsborough offer historic charm along the Eno River, and rural areas throughout the county provide estate properties and farmland that appeal to buyers seeking privacy and natural beauty within the Triangle's commuting distance.

Market Dynamics and Geographic Complexity

Orange County's real estate market operates on multiple tiers, with university-adjacent properties maintaining different seasonal patterns than traditional residential markets, as academic calendars influence both sales timing and rental markets. The county's commitment to smart growth and land preservation has created artificial scarcity in developable land, particularly around Chapel Hill, driving prices higher while maintaining the rural character that attracts many residents seeking an escape from urban density.

Geographic complexity defines this market, where a five-minute drive can separate million-dollar neighborhoods from rural farmland, requiring agents to understand everything from historic preservation guidelines in downtown Chapel Hill to septic regulations for rural properties. The presence of major healthcare systems, research facilities, and the university creates a buyer pool with specific needs around commute patterns, school districts, and lifestyle preferences that differ significantly from typical suburban markets.
